W9XPV-W9XPN — WDZ Broadcasting Co., Tuscola, Ill. — Granted authority to operate as licensed for period 30 days from January 23 to February 21 for relay broadcast from train between Villagrove and Tuscola, Ill. WGBD-WJLF — WBNS, Inc., Columbus, Ohio. — Granted authority to operate as licensed for period of 10 days from date for emergency use in connection with flood in vicinity of Ports¬ mouth, Ohio. W10XFR — National Broadcasting Co., New York. — Granted au¬ thority to operate as licensed from January 31 to February 5, inclusive, connection program Inquiring Reporter. WIEX-WMFS — National Broadcasting Co., New York. — Granted authority to operate as licensed January 28 to February 6, inclusive, relay broadcast connection flood relief program. W8XIQ-W8XIR— WGAR Broadcasting Co., Cleveland, Ohio. — Granted authority to operate as licensed for period of 10 days beginning this date for emergency use in flood area. WIEK-W10XGJ — Columbia Broadcasting System, Inc., New York City. — Granted authority to operate as licensed January 28 in connection with National Aviation Show. W6XKL-KADB-KIFO — Nichols & Warinner, Inc., Long Beach, Calif. — Granted authority to operate stations as licensed, period 15 days from January 21 to February 4, provided Commission is advised by telegram sent before broadcast, the requirements of Rule 1002. Nature of program to be settlement of maritime strike, vicinity San Pedro harbor. Renewal of this authority may be requested before expira¬ tion of 15-day period. WHBE — Onondaga Radio Broadcasting Corp., Syracuse, N. Y. — Granted authority to operate as licensed, period not to exceed 10 days, relay broadcast Red Cross relief duty at Scott Field. W3XEM-W3XEL — WFIL Broadcasting Co., Philadelphia, Pa.— Granted authority to operate as licensed, period of 10 days, relay broadcast for relief work during flood at Louisville. W4XBT-WAAK-W4XBZ — Radio Station WSCC, Charlotte, N. C. — Granted authority to operate as licensed for period 1 week from date, connection Red Cross drive. KARK — Arkansas Radio & Equipment Co., Little Rock, Ark. — Granted authority KARK to operate with 1 KW night to transmit emergency messages only for duration of flood emergency in accordance with Rule 23. WREC — WREC, Inc., Memphis, Tenn. — Granted authority re¬ broadcast by WREC of amateur station W5BKD of material aiding emergency flood relief work as set forth in Rule 23. KARK — Arkansas Radio & Equipment Co., Little Rock, Ark. — Granted authority use old KARK transmitter, located at 212 Center St., accordance with terms of license dated August 29, 1936, in event flood waters render new transmitter in¬ operative, for period not to exceed 30 days, in accordance Rule 23.
